Recent years have seen a huge rise in so-called "predatory" journals that seek to exploit 바카라사이트 open-access model of publishing for financial gain.
One trend has been 바카라사이트 flood of "hijacked journals", which are, essentially, counterfeit websites for already-existing, mostly print-only, genuine journals. Last month, Mehrdad Jalalian, editor-in-chief of 바카라사이트 medical and health sciences journal Electronic Physician, based in Mashhad, Iran, reported on 바카라사이트 which make money when unsuspecting academics pay a fee to publish in 바카라사이트m.
¡°I do not believe that publishing in fake or hijacked journals is [necessarily] unethical conduct,¡± says Dr Jalalian, given that 바카라사이트 authors of 바카라사이트se articles may not be to blame. Instead, he adds, 바카라사이트ir institutions must also be held accountable for not training 바카라사이트m on publication ethics.??
However, one does have to sympathise with 바카라사이트 scholars who have been tricked in such a way. Researchers worldwide have contacted Dr Jalalian to express 바카라사이트ir concern about 바카라사이트ir academic credibility being damaged after naively publishing research in hijacked journals.
Dr Jalalian, thus, raises an important question in : ¡°Is 바카라사이트 legitimate author allowed to republish her/his article in a legitimate journal ¨C or would that constitute duplicate publication?¡±
It¡¯s a question that has no easy answer, but one that I think needs to addressed, if not for 바카라사이트 sake of 바카라사이트 academics that have been conned, 바카라사이트n for 바카라사이트 legitimate research that is locked up on 바카라사이트se dodgy websites.
Dr Jalalian says 바카라사이트re are hundreds if not thousands of genuine papers stuck in hijacked journals. These papers should be labelled ¡°stolen¡±, he says, and 바카라사이트 authors should 바카라사이트refore be allowed to republish 바카라사이트ir papers in a legitimate journal after peer review.
¡°We believe it is better to vaccinate 바카라사이트 academic world against 바카라사이트 poisonous effects of both 바카라사이트 hijacked and questionable journals before it is too late,¡± Dr Jalalian wrote in .
Several lists that highlight suspected predatory publishers and journals , but Dr Jalalian suggests that a more effective method of monitoring journals may be to make a list of legitimate journals, and sticking to 바카라사이트se approved journals when submitting new papers. ?
Last month, in a proposal to 바카라사이트 Committee on Publication Ethics, Dr Jalalian suggested designing a flowchart outlining 바카라사이트 procedure of republishing legitimate papers. The next question, he notes, is whe바카라사이트r journals will be willing to publish 바카라사이트se recycled articles.
Some scholars may have have published in hijacked journals deliberately, but many would have done so unintentionally. There is, 바카라사이트refore, a need to distinguish between 바카라사이트 unethical approaches of some researchers from 바카라사이트 innocent naivety of o바카라사이트rs.
